Autor | Zpráva | ||
---|---|---|---|
Kenik01 Profil |
#1 · Zasláno: 15. 6. 2012, 10:43:22
Zdravím dostal jsem se k projektu, kde chceme přejít z kódování HTML kódu z iso-8859-2 na utf8. ( min. vadí v RSS čtečkám)
Problém je ten, že stávající Mysql DB je již nastavena na utf8_czech_ci a výstup scriptů (MDB2 ) zobrazuje i ukládá korektně. Jenomže v phpmyadminu a při přepnutí systému na UTF-8 vidíme namísto: Loď čeří kýlem tůň obzvlášť v Grónské úžině. LOĎ ČEŘÍ KÝLEM TŮŇ OBZVLÁŠŤ V GRÓNSKÉ ÚŽINĚ. toto: Loï èeøí kýlem tùò obzvlá¹» v Grónské ú¾inì. LOÏ ÈEØÍ KÝLEM TÙÒ OBZVLÁ©« V GRÓNSKÉ Ú®INÌ. Což odpovídá: zdroj: Problémy s češtinou Jak z toho ven? Evidentně potřebuje vyexportovat a nějak "trasnformovat" do UTF-8 Zkoušel jsem přepínat různě načtení sql exportu v různých kodováních v editorech ( PSPad, Geany) ale bez úspěchu. Jedíné co mne napadá a dokáži je BF akce. Najít a nahradit znaky odpovídající ěščřžů ďťň. To mi ale přijde nebezpečné nahrazené znaky se mohou přirozeně objevovat + se obávám že nezahrne všechny "zkomolené znaky" Předem díky. Yuhů: G+ a díky za zdroj: Problémy s češtinou |
||
Jan Tvrdík Profil |
#2 · Zasláno: 15. 6. 2012, 10:50:36
Kenik01:
Zkus vyexportovat databázi do SQL souboru. Ten otevřít jako iso-8859-2 (takže bys měl vidět text v pořádku), uložit jako utf-8 a znova importovat. |
||
Kajman Profil |
#3 · Zasláno: 15. 6. 2012, 10:54:04
Nebo to vyexportovat s nastavením latin1 (defaultní nastavení mysql serveru), viz. např. problem s kodovanim
|
||
Kenik01 Profil |
Jan Tvrdík:
Právě že ten deafultní export jsme zkoušel načíst jako všechan možná formátování a bez úspěchu Kajman: BINGO dal jsem v PHPmyAdminu / Export formát SQL kodování: iso-8859-1 otebřu to jako iso-8859-2 čitelně Díky moc |
||
Časová prodleva: 12 let
|
0